HC Deb 14 March 1967 vol 743 cc69-70W
Mr. Awdry

asked the Minister of Transport what action has been taken to implement recommendations 6, 12, 16, 26 and 33, respectively, of the Economic Development Council report, Efficiency in Road Construction.

Mrs. Castle

Following is the informationRecommendation 6: Both the economic and contractual aspects of this present considerable difficulties, and I must await the outcome of the investigation into serial contracting (being undertaken in accordance with Recommendation 26) before reaching a conclusion. Recommendation 12: As a first step contractors are now being given a quarterly forecast of starting dates for all trunk road schemes for two years ahead, in accordance with Recommendation 38. Forecasts for specific materials are more difficult, but I hope to provide forecasts of roadstone requirements soon. Recommendation 16: A detailed examination of the further extent to which savings could be achieved is almost complete. Recommendation 26: Consultants have been appointed to undertake an extensive study of the size and phasing of contracts, and in particular of the practicability of serial contracting in relation to roadworks; their report is expected by the Summer. Recommendation 33: I have already indicated my misgivings about this recommendation.
